Fred passed to a new place to dance on November 30, 2024, in Maplewood, Minnesota.
Fred was born on July 4, 1951, in Trinidad, Colorado to Albert Frederick and Marie.
Fred is survived by former wife, Carol, and their children, Christopher Chad (Sarah) Corich, Lee Corich, Andrea Corich, and Alicia (John) Boyd; grandchildren, Riley Corich, Leonard “Lenny” Corich, Lydia Fallon Boyd, and Kiernan Boyd; siblings, Caroline (Joe) Trujillo, Michael (Suzanne) Abruzzi, Glori Ann (Buck Hakes) Thurston, Bill (Desiree) Corich, and Melanie (Bill) Fenton; and numerous nephews and nieces. He also leaves behind his partner, Diane Zins.
Fred was preceded in death by son, Daniel Corich; parents, Albert Frederick and Marie Corich; and grandparents, Giovanni John (Mary Ella) Toti, Soletta Jolitz, Pete Corich, and Caroline (Mike) Cox.
Celebration of life Thursday, January 9, 2025, 4:00 pm - 6:30 pm at Cedarholm Golf Course, 2323 Hamline Ave., Roseville, Minnesota.
In lieu of flowers, the family asks that you honor Fred's memory on the dance floor or on the golf course, two of his favorite activities.
